The three founding partners of Gobi Partners, a venture fund investments in IT early start and a digital media company in China, plans to raise a second fund. The first $ 51.75 million is close to fully invested and the portfolio companies are doing well, with two subsequent raising financing at significantly increased valuation. The firm has increased its staff and opened a second office, but he, however, did not leave any of his companies. How much money should be partners hope to raise, and from whom? The stakes are high, since none of them received a salary of three years. "Hide
